The key is to make SMART resolutions. Over the years, we have learned how to set goals that are reasonable and that will lead to success. We encourage sales executives to apply a simple test to their business resolutions. Ask if it's SMART: specific, measurable, activity-based, realistic and time-bound? If they meet these criteria their success will escalate.
